電腦應(yīng)用程序無法正常啟動(dòng)的情況常常會(huì)出現(xiàn),其中最常見的一種錯(cuò)誤代碼是 0xc0000022。這個(gè)錯(cuò)誤可能是由于系統(tǒng)文件損壞、缺少必要的運(yùn)行庫或權(quán)限不足等原因引起的。下面將為您介紹5種常見的解決方案,幫助您輕松修復(fù)該問題并恢復(fù)應(yīng)用程序的正常啟動(dòng)。
一、檢查并修復(fù)系統(tǒng)文件
0xc0000022 錯(cuò)誤有時(shí)與操作系統(tǒng)文件損壞有關(guān)。Windows系統(tǒng)中,有一些關(guān)鍵的系統(tǒng)文件負(fù)責(zé)程序的正常啟動(dòng)和運(yùn)行。如果這些文件受損,可能會(huì)導(dǎo)致程序無法啟動(dòng)并拋出該錯(cuò)誤代碼。Windows自帶的系統(tǒng)文件檢查工具(SFC)可以幫助掃描并修復(fù)這些文件。
在電腦搜索欄輸入cmd,右鍵點(diǎn)擊命令提示符,選擇以管理員身份運(yùn)行。
在打開的命令提示符窗口中,輸入以下命令并按回車:
sfc /scannow
系統(tǒng)將開始掃描并修復(fù)損壞的文件。這個(gè)過程可能需要一些時(shí)間,具體時(shí)間取決于系統(tǒng)的性能和文件損壞的程度。
掃描完成后,重啟電腦并檢查問題是否已解決。
二、使用“DISM”工具修復(fù)系統(tǒng)
除了SFC工具之外,Windows還提供了一個(gè)更為強(qiáng)大的工具——DISM(Deployment Imaging Service and Management Tool),它可以修復(fù)系統(tǒng)映像和一些較為復(fù)雜的問題。如果SFC工具沒有解決問題,可以嘗試使用DISM工具進(jìn)行更深入的修復(fù)。
按下 Win + X 鍵,選擇Windows PowerShell(管理員)。
在命令提示符窗口中,輸入以下命令并按回車:
DISM /Online /Cleanup-Image /RestoreHealth
該命令將掃描系統(tǒng)映像并修復(fù)任何損壞的文件。如果出現(xiàn)錯(cuò)誤,DISM會(huì)嘗試通過互聯(lián)網(wǎng)下載必要的修復(fù)文件。
完成后,重啟電腦并檢查錯(cuò)誤是否消失。
三、檢查程序的兼容性和權(quán)限問題
有時(shí),0xc0000022 錯(cuò)誤可能是由于應(yīng)用程序與操作系統(tǒng)不兼容,或當(dāng)前用戶沒有足夠的權(quán)限來啟動(dòng)程序。尤其是在嘗試運(yùn)行舊版本的程序或管理員權(quán)限不足時(shí),可能會(huì)遇到此錯(cuò)誤。
1、檢查程序兼容性
右鍵點(diǎn)擊應(yīng)用程序的快捷方式或執(zhí)行文件(.exe),選擇 屬性,然后切換到 兼容性 標(biāo)簽頁。
勾選“以兼容模式運(yùn)行這個(gè)程序”,然后選擇一個(gè)較舊的Windows版本(如Windows 7或Windows XP),并點(diǎn)擊 應(yīng)用 和 確定。
2、以管理員身份運(yùn)行
右鍵點(diǎn)擊應(yīng)用程序的快捷方式,選擇 以管理員身份運(yùn)行。
如果此操作有效,可以右鍵點(diǎn)擊程序圖標(biāo),選擇 屬性,然后在 兼容性 標(biāo)簽頁下勾選“以管理員身份運(yùn)行此程序”,以便以后每次啟動(dòng)時(shí)自動(dòng)擁有管理員權(quán)限。
四、更新或安裝必要的運(yùn)行庫
許多應(yīng)用程序依賴于特定的運(yùn)行庫,如 Microsoft Visual C++ 運(yùn)行庫、.NET Framework 等丟失或損壞,可能會(huì)導(dǎo)致應(yīng)用程序無法正常啟動(dòng)并拋出 0xc0000022 錯(cuò)誤。一個(gè)簡單便捷的方法是使用星空運(yùn)行庫修復(fù)大師來自動(dòng)檢測和修復(fù)這些問題。
打開已安裝的星空運(yùn)行庫修復(fù)大師,點(diǎn)擊掃描,軟件會(huì)自動(dòng)開始掃描您的系統(tǒng),識(shí)別出可能缺失或損壞的運(yùn)行庫文件。
在掃描結(jié)果中,軟件會(huì)列出所有需要修復(fù)的運(yùn)行庫文件。點(diǎn)擊“一鍵修復(fù)”按鈕,軟件將自動(dòng)下載并修復(fù)這些庫文件。
修復(fù)完成后重啟電腦,確保所有修復(fù)操作生效。再次嘗試啟動(dòng)應(yīng)用程序,檢查 0xc0000022 錯(cuò)誤是否已被修復(fù)。
五、重新安裝應(yīng)用程序
如果您已經(jīng)嘗試了上述方法,仍然無法解決 0xc0000022 錯(cuò)誤,可能是由于程序本身的文件損壞或不完整。此時(shí),卸載并重新安裝應(yīng)用程序是一個(gè)有效的解決方案。
打開 控制面板 > 程序 > 程序和功能。
找到出問題的應(yīng)用程序,點(diǎn)擊卸載。
完成卸載后,重新下載安裝程序,并按提示安裝應(yīng)用程序。
安裝完成后,嘗試重新啟動(dòng)應(yīng)用程序,檢查錯(cuò)誤是否消失。
以上就是應(yīng)用程序無法正常啟動(dòng)0xc0000022的解決方法。希望對(duì)大家有所幫助。如果遇到網(wǎng)卡、顯卡、藍(lán)牙、聲卡等驅(qū)動(dòng)的相關(guān)問題都可以下載“驅(qū)動(dòng)人生”進(jìn)行檢測修復(fù),同時(shí)驅(qū)動(dòng)人生支持驅(qū)動(dòng)下載、驅(qū)動(dòng)安裝、驅(qū)動(dòng)備份等等,可以靈活的安裝驅(qū)動(dòng)。